Hello New Mexico,

I have been trying to monitor Taos here in Los Alamos for the last couple months and have discovered a few things.

Transmit 154.95 Receive 155.97 (mostly law, but have heard fire/ems)
Transmit 153.905 Receive 154.07 (mostly law, but have heard fire/ems)
Transmit 154.055 Receive 155.895 (have only heard county fire/ems out of city)

It seems all law and fire/ems is centrally dispatched because I usually hear "Taos Central Dispatch" in most transmissions. The 155.97 seems to be mostly for the city.

I am wondering if it is a North/South issue with the first two sets of freqs. If you do a search on the FCC site the 154.07 is not registered to the County or the City....which seems weird.

We have all seen 155.19 in the books and on the web pages as Taos County Sheriff. I think this is false. The only thing I ever hear is UNM Police. Have you heard any Taos transmissions on this freq?

Thanks in advance for any confirmed knowledge you have about these frequencies or how they run the police/sheriff/fire/ems in the area.

PS: State Police in the area use 154.935 base and 156.105 mobiles
